Abstract

323,304. Waite, R. T. Oct. 31, 1928. Arresting a moving model by competitive control, apparatus for.-The invention relates to a games apparatus of the type in which each of several players endeavours to arrest a moving object, and consists in providing the players with switches connected to solenoids, an operation of one of the switches at the proper time causing the core of the corresponding solenoid to be suddenly jerked upwards to engage the moving object. The solenoid circuits also remain broken at another point excepting when the object is in a certain position with respect to any particular solenoid, when the corresponding circuit is closed. All the circuits are under the control of a master switch. A miniature hare 6, Fig. 1, attached to a horizontal arm 8 is followed by the representation 5 of a dog attached to an arm 7. The latter arm 7 is secured to a vertical spindle 9 and the former arm 8 is rotatably mounted upon the vertical spindle, the two arms being connected by a spring 19 so that the fixed arm 7 pulls the free arm 8 round with it when the vertical spindle rotates, but should the free arm 8 be arrested, the fixed arm 7, will continue its motion as far as the spring 19 will allow. The free arm 8 may carry an electric bulb 22. The vertical spindle 9 is rotated by any convenient means and its speed may be varied. Each player can operate a switch 10 connected to a conducting arc 11 with which a member 12 depending from the, free arm 8 contacts as that arm revolves. This contacting member 12 is connected to a second similar member 13 which continuously contacts with a metal ring 14, whence the circuits are completed through an adjustable resistance 20 to a master switch and source of power (not shown). Between each switch 10 and its corresponding arc 11 is interposed a solenoid 15 having a core 16 which, if the switch is operated at the correct instant, will be lifted into engagement with a portion 17 of the free arm 8 and thus arrest the latter. If the switch is operated incorrectly, the core 16 rises to its maximum position and then falls to a lower stable position without engaging' with the arm 8. The height to which the core rises can be varied by adjusting the resistance 20. In a modification, Fig. 3, a pointer moves over a scale (not shown) the pointer being fixed to a spindle 24 to which is also secured a drum 26 of non-magnetic material having in its side a series of holes 27. A fixed solenoid 29 has a core which can be jerked into the holes so as to arrest the drum upon the initial completion of a circuit, but if the circuit is made continuously the core will remain in a lower stable position clear of the holes. Each of a number of switches 32 is connected to a separate arc 31, and as the drum and pointer rotate a member 34 connects the arcs each in turn to a ring 30 from which the circuit is completed through the solenoid 29 and master switch 33, so that a correct operation of a switch by a player will arrest the drum. Instead of a pointer, a slotted disc or an illuminated device may be used to indicate to the players the correct times for closing the switches.
